WebThe use of uncuffed endotracheal tubes (ETT) in patients younger than 8 years old has been in practice for the last 60 years. In the last decade, there has been a change in clinical practice with a transition to cuffed ETT use, and there continues to be debate between cuffed vs uncuffed ETT use. Webthe 1960s,1 uncuffed endotracheal tubes (ETTs) replaced tracheostomies for long-term intubation and ventilation in the intensive care unit (ICU). Since then, uncuffed ETTs have traditionally been used in infants and children under the age of eight (or even ten) years for both short- and long-term intubation in theatre and ICU.
